An object that is responsible for the asynchronous execution of a socket server.

This interface exists primarily to allow the runner to be mocked for the purpose of unit testing the socket server implementation.

Stops execution of the runner.

This method must cause all I/O and thread resources associated with the runner to be released. If the receiver has not been started, this method must have no effect.
